Circular Industrial
Positive Seal Valve (Damper)
M & I's 12-inch Circular Industrial Positive Seal
Valve was tested for 250,000 open/close cycles by an independent
testing laboratory. (This number of cycles coul
represent 100 years or more of normal field operation). Using
the Pressure Decay Test Method*, the valve's leakage test result
was 2.18 x 10-1 cfm at 10 inch W.G. pressure differential
(1.03 x 10 -8M3/s at 2.5 KPa).
Square Industrial Positive Seal Damper
M & I's engineering team has tested a series of 4-foot
x 6-foot (1219 mm x 1829 mm) damper banks each consisting of six
24-inch Positive Seal Dampers controlled by three jackshafted
N.C. spring return actuators. Using the Pressure Decay Method*,
the damper's average leakage was 1.47 x 10-5 cfm/ft'
at 10 inch W.G. pressure differential (7.47 x 10-8M3/S/
mlat 2.5 KPa).
*The Pressure Decay Method determines the leakage rate of a damper
or housing by the change in air pressure within an enclosure over
a period of time. The leakage rate is calculated by taking into
account factors such as air temperature, barometric pressure,
change in absolute pressure, air volume and duration of the test.
(As per ANSI/ASME N510).
General Description

Circular Industrial
Positive Seal Damper (Valve)
M & I's Circular Industrial Positive Seal Damper (valve)
is designed for sealing round ducts and pipes.
This damper is available in six standard sizes, 12, 16, 24, 36,
48 and 60-inch diameters (305, 406, 610, 914, 1219, and 1524 mm
respectively). It is equipped with two flanges for easy field connection
to flanges of round ducts and pipes. Special sizes and flanges can
be provided.

NOTE A: The rotating
disc is controlled by an actuator located outside of the air stream
through a jackshaft sized to prevent distortion during operation.
This ensures a tight seal. The integrity of the damper housing,
at the point where the jackshaft penetrates, is achieved through
M&I's exclusive tandem seals. The seals can be serviced from
outside the damper housing.
NOTE B: Materials of construction.
Casing: Mild steel or 304 stainless steel.
Dish: Spun galvanized or 304 stainless steel.
Shaft: 304 stainless steel.
Linkages: 304 stainless steel and high density polyethylene.
Gasket: Extruded neoprene or silicone.
Bearings: Nylon.
Tandem seal casing: 304 stainless steel.
Tandem seals: Nitroxile
Other special materials such as 316 stainless steel construction
is available.

Square Industrial
Positive Seal Damper
M & I's Square Industrial Positive Seal Damper is designed
for use as a single damper in duct-work, or grouped to form a rectangular
damper bank of virtually any size.
The square damper is available in four standard modules: 12, 16,
24 and 36 inches (305, 406, 610 and 914 mm respectively).
For damper banks larger than 36" x 36" (914 mm x 914 mm),
multiple Positive Seal Damper modules would be assembled together
within a common frame and shipped as a single assembly to ensure
that the quality and integrity of the end product is maintained.
